Ely walks 7/8 mile in 1/3 hour. what is his speed miles per hour?

<span>7/8 mile in 1/3 hour

7/8 * 3 = 21/8 </span><span><span>(miles per hour)
</span>21:8 = 2.625 (miles per hour)

Does anyone know what the slope for C = 22.5 - (1/160)m
Lunna [17]

The slope of the linear equation, C = 22.5 - (\frac{1}{160}) m, is: -\frac{1}{160}

<em><u>Recall:</u></em>

  • A linear equation in slope-intercept form is given as: <em>y = mx + b.</em>
  • "m" is the slope.
  • "b" is the y-intercept.

Thus, given the linear equation:

C = 22.5 - (\frac{1}{160}) m,

C represents y

m represents x

-\frac{1}{160} represents the slope (m)

22.5 represents b.

Therefore, the slope of the linear equation, C = 22.5 - (\frac{1}{160}) m, is: -\frac{1}{160}
